Thousands Volunteer for 14th Annual Day of Caring

By Mark Scott

Buffalo, NY – Thousands of volunteers participated in Wednesday's 14th annual United Way Day of Caring. It marks the official start of the fundraising agency's Community Care campaign.

United Way President Arlene Kaukus says more than 160 companies in the area agreed to let their employees spend the day helping others.

"In Erie County alone, we had close to 3,400 folks volunteering," Kaukus said. "That's an awesome number. At the end of the day, they're going to drive back into the community about $250,000 worth of work."

Kaukus says Day of Caring participants will be painting, landscaping, taking kids on field trips, providing meals to the elderly and more. She says it gives participants first-hand knowledge about how their donations to the Community Care campaign are being used.
